Finances and Funding

WAZA currently has a total annual budget of ca. 800,000 Swiss Francs (this equals to ca. 550,000 € or 800,000 US$). The majority (95%) of the annual revenue comes from membership fees.

 

WAZA provides support and services to its members, raises awareness about zoos and aquariums through publications, the Internet and media work and also takes part in international conferences. WAZA is liaising with international partner organizations and is campaigning and lobbying for conservation. On a yearly basis, WAZA also awards a grant for training purposes and supports field projects for conservation of its members.

 

About 50% of WAZA's expenses are salaries, 15% is support of partner organizations and conservation and 16% are spent on communication and marketing; the rest covers running costs of office, travel and miscellaneous.
